Improved Anonymity
In the traditional financial system, betting transactions frequently appear on bank declarations, which can be problematic for people looking for privacy. Crypto casinos permit users to play using a wallet address, keeping their video gaming practices different from their personal banking history.
2. Lightning-Fast Payouts
Standard online casinos are well-known for "pending durations" where withdrawals can be held for several days. Crypto gambling establishments remove the intermediary. When a withdrawal is authorized, the funds generally arrive in the user's digital wallet in a matter of minutes.
3. Provably Fair Technology
One of the greatest developments in the area is "Provably Fair" gaming. In a physical casino, you trust the dealer; in a conventional online casino, you rely on the software company. In a provably reasonable crypto casino, the gamer is offered with a "hash" or a seed before the video game begins. This permits the player to mathematically validate that the outcome was not tampered with, cultivating a level of trust that was formerly impossible.
4. International Accessibility
Numerous nations have rigorous banking guidelines that prevent major banks from processing deals to online gambling websites. Cryptocurrencies transcend these borders, enabling gamers from across the globe to participate offered they have internet gain access to and a crypto wallet.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Q)
1. Are crypto casinos legal?The legality depends upon your jurisdiction. While crypto casinos are often certified in jurisdictions like Curacao, your local laws might restrict online gambling. Constantly check your regional regulations before registering.
2. Which cryptocurrencies are best for gaming?Bitcoin (BTC) is the most extensively accepted. Ethereum (ETH) and Litecoin (LTC) are also popular due to their faster deal speeds and lower network charges compared to the Bitcoin network.

4. What are "betting requirements"?These are conditions connected to casino perks. If a reward has a 30x wagering requirement, you need to wager the benefit amount 30 times before the funds end up being qualified for withdrawal.
5. How can I ensure a site is "Provably Fair"?Try to find a "Provably Fair" tab in the game settings. The site needs to offer guidelines on how to utilize a random seed to verify the win/loss result utilizing a third-party hashing tool.
